‘Thief in the Shadows’ is one such tale. Butler’s Audio Drama guides listeners through a riveting story packed with unexpected twists and turns. Full of playful adventure, this fast-paced tale follows the life of Allie, a thief who goes about her life of heists, petty thievery and running from guards until one day she is presented with a mystery. This short story will leave you wanting to know more thanks to its enchanting nature. The attention to detail and well-written characters provide the means for immersing listeners into the story and crafting a connection between the characters and listeners in a short space of time. It is an excellent example of how the immersion of storytelling and audio can be so powerful in entrancing audiences.
